fix(apply): run the page-count check Step 5b claimed Step 5d already ran (#476)
Step 5b's prose said "Page count is not checked here - that is verify_pdf.py --pages's job, and Step 5d already runs it", and verify_layout.py's docstring declines to measure page count for the same reason. Step 5d's only verify_pdf.py call is --dump-text, and no step in the workflow passed --pages at all (only the upstream-only CI assertion on the stock examples does), so the hard 2-page CV and 1-page cover letter limits were enforced by nothing but the visual PDF read - the "measure first, then look" failure 5b was written to stop. 5b now runs verify_pdf.py --pages 2 on the CV and --pages 1 on the cover letter ahead of verify_layout.py, names the ACTIVE-TEMPLATE page limit as the substitute for a custom template, and the deferral sentence points at those lines instead of at 5d. tests/test_apply_page_count.py pins the invocations, their counts, their order relative to the layout measurement, and that no prose defers the check to a step that does not run it; all four cases fail on master.
